11.13. Resolución de problemas de gestión de volúmenes en GNOME
A continuación se muestran algunos errores comunes de la gestión de volúmenes en GNOME y las formas de resolverlos.
11.13.1. Solución de problemas de acceso a ubicaciones GVFS desde clientes que no son GIO
Si tiene problemas para acceder a las ubicaciones de GVFS desde su aplicación, puede significar que no es un cliente GIO nativo. Los clientes nativos de GIO suelen ser todas las aplicaciones de Gnome que utilizan las bibliotecas de Gnome (glib, gio
). El servicio gvfs-fuse
se proporciona como una alternativa para los clientes que no son GIO.
Requisito previo
Tiene instalado el paquete
gvfs-fuse
.$ dnf install gvfs-fuse
Procedimiento
Asegúrese de que
gvfs-fuse
está funcionando.$ ps ax | grep gvfsd-fuse
Dado que
gvfs-fuse
se ejecuta automáticamente y no se recomienda iniciarlo por sí mismo, pruebe a cerrar la sesión e iniciarla, sigvfs-fuse
no se está ejecutando.Encuentre el ID de usuario del sistema (UID) para la
/run/user/UID/gvfs/
ejecutando el comandoid
, el demoniogvfsd-fuse
requiere una ruta en la que se supone que debe exponer sus servicios o, cuando la ruta/run/user/UID/gvfs/
ruta no está disponible,gvfsd-fuse
utiliza una ruta.gvfs
en su directorio personal.$ id -u
Si
gvfsd-fuse
aún no se está ejecutando, inicie el demoniogvfsd-fuse
:$ /usr/libexec/gvfsd-fuse -f /run/user/UID/gvfs
Ahora, el montaje de FUSE está disponible, y puedes buscar manualmente la ruta en tu aplicación.
- Encuentre los montajes GVFS en las ubicaciones /run/user/UID/gvfs/ o .gvfs.